well

when Brooks made this piece.....he did an excellent job....but he may have mixed a slight bit hot....because it warped a lil bit...and it wasnt fitting ...the way I wanted it to fit...

Posted Image

so I did some grinding,cutting,and bracing untill it was tight like a frogs ass

at the bottom of the panel.....(under the green tape) there are 4 blocks holding the panel....where it needs to be

and the 4 boards wedged in at the top.....they are to keep the top where it needs to be...

i also had i different approach to the trunk latch ....so more trimming....

Posted Image

once it was all braced in place....i glassed it up thick....and let it kick
